IDNA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review
73 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Genomics Immunology and Healthcare ETF (IDNA)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$57.1M — down 23% from $73.8M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 22 funds closed out of IDNA and 11 opened new positions — a net loss of 11 holders — while 22 trimmed existing stakes and 15 added.
The largest buyer was Wharton Business Group, adding an estimated $2.25M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$6.06M.
